Prince William Suspected Meghan Markle Used Royal Life For Stardom, Biographer Claims
Royal biographer Phil Dampier has shared that Prince William had early doubts about Meghan Markle’s intentions earlier than she formally joined the royal household.
The longer term king, 43, is alleged to have been cautious of the Duchess of Sussex’s motives, suspecting that she could have considered her marriage to Prince Harry as a path to better fame relatively than a long-term dedication to royal duties.
Chatting with The Sun, Dampier mentioned, “This actually reinforces what I’ve believed for a very long time: Meghan by no means really supposed to remain within the royal household. Marrying Harry appeared extra like a launchpad than a lifelong function. William picked up on that early, and it created rigidity between the brothers.”

The Late Queen Was ‘Not Content material’ With Harry And Meghan’s Wedding ceremony Selections

The claims a couple of cultural conflict align with posthumously revealed feedback from Girl Anson, who opened up in an interview for the Times of London with royal creator Sally Bedell Smith.
In the course of the interview, Anson recalled a key second of rigidity forward of the Sussexes’ 2018 marriage ceremony.
She mentioned Harry had written to her claiming the queen authorised of the couple’s choice to have the Archbishop of Canterbury officiate the ceremony at St George’s Chapel, with out first acquiring permission from the Dean of Windsor.

“[Prince] Harry wrote to me and mentioned they had been going one other manner. He mentioned, ‘I’m near my grandmother, and she or he is content material with this,'” Anson recounted to Bedell Smith. “Once I spoke with the queen, she mentioned she is under no circumstances content material. Meghan may flip into nothing however bother. She sees issues another way.”
Queen Elizabeth II Was Left ‘Dismayed’ By Harry And Meghan Forward Of Their Wedding ceremony

Anson went on to clarify that the queen was “dismayed” by Harry’s assumption that she may override long-standing protocol.
“Harry appears to assume the queen can do what she desires, however she will be able to’t. On the non secular facet, it’s the Dean of Windsor’s jurisdiction,” she reportedly mentioned.
The queen was mentioned to be deeply harm by the incident. “She mentioned she was actually upset. I used to be shocked when the queen informed me this, how she was so saddened,” Anson revealed.
After the marriage, Anson claimed that Harry and Meghan started to slowly distance themselves from William and Kate Middleton. Tensions, she famous, had been significantly evident between Meghan and Kate.
